Czech Government Scholarships 2027/2028 for Students from Developing Countries

Brief Description

The Czech Government Scholarships 2027/2028 offer an incredible pathway for international students from selected developing and specific third countries to pursue fully funded scholarships for advanced degrees in Europe. Established by the Government of the Czech Republic as part of its Foreign Development Cooperation, this long-running initiative has welcomed more than 20,000 scholars since the late 1950s. If you are looking to advance your academic career through Master’s and Doctoral programmes at public higher education institutions, this opportunity is built for your ambitions. You can choose between Czech-language tracks featuring a dedicated preparatory year or English-language programmes designed to match your specific professional and academic background.

Name of Host Institution

The Government of the Czech Republic, implemented jointly by the Czech Ministry of Education, Youth and Sports and the Ministry of Foreign Affairs, in cooperation with the Ministry of Health.

Requirements/Eligibility Criteria

  • Must be a citizen of an eligible developing country or specific third country meeting official scholarship guidelines.
  • Must hold a completed Bachelor’s degree or equivalent undergraduate qualification if you are applying for a follow-up Master’s programme.
  • Must hold a completed Master’s degree or equivalent postgraduate qualification if you are applying for a Doctoral scholarship.
  • Must complete an online English-language entrance test during the application process if you are applying for English-medium programmes.
  • Must register only once and submit a single electronic application through the official portal.

Deadline

30 September 2026 (Applications opened on 21 August 2026).

Q: Can I apply for both Master's and Doctoral studies?

Yes, you can apply for selected two-year follow-up Master's programmes or three- to four-year Doctoral programmes, depending on your prior academic qualifications.

Q: Is there a language test required for English-medium tracks?

Yes, candidates applying for English-medium programmes must complete an online English-language entrance test during the application process to demonstrate adequate command of the language.
